Output 709debebf9236ad8eb5e8374022094866fa52d63a4e0548c7a9461774e1f2d39:1

value
11355807460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56f6ba57a003b82032e9d8b09ba2ee5729a9ce05 OP_EQUAL
address
MFpyut9KjqScFPksgFpW7ko7e9BG2mEC8o
transaction
709debebf9236ad8eb5e8374022094866fa52d63a4e0548c7a9461774e1f2d39
spent
true